WebApr 10, 2024 · Inhale and sit up as tall as you can, lengthening your spine and reaching the crown of your head toward the ceiling. Exhale and twist to one side. Inhale twisting back to the center (lengthening up as much as you can!) and exhale twist to the other side. Repeat for 5-8 twists to each side. WebLying lengthwise on the foam roller, clasp your hands together in front of you, above your chest with arms straight. Slowly move your arms above your head until you feel a good stretch. This exercise should be PAIN FREE. Hold stretch for 30-60 seconds. Opposite Arm Reach Lying lengthwise on the foam roller, reach your hands in opposite ...
